The Eighth Conference of Chinese and African Entrepreneurs was held on September 6, 2024, in Beijing, bringing together business leaders from China and African nations. Entrepreneurs shared their experiences and explored future cooperation opportunities. In an interview with Guangming Daily, Elizabeth Thebe, CEO of the Progressive Business Forum, emphasized the importance of global collaboration, stating, “We are one global community. In this community, it’s crucial to know your role and how to contribute.” Thebe, accompanied by 22 delegates from sectors including agriculture, mining, and technology, expressed optimism for future partnerships following multiple agreements signed during the event.
